
Enable job alerts via email!
Generate a tailored resume in minutes
Land an interview and earn more. Learn more
A leading landscape services company in the United Kingdom seeks a Site Manager to oversee soft landscaping projects. The role involves managing daily operations, ensuring client satisfaction, and maintaining high standards of safety and financial performance. The ideal candidate will exhibit strong leadership qualities, excellent communication skills, and a proactive approach to managing staff and client relationships. A valid driving license is required along with a solid understanding of landscape installation and project management.